BIO-203 Ecology, Evolution & Diversity3 credits
Prerequisites: BIO-202 and MAT-112 or MAT-212
This is the third course in a three semester sequence for Biology majors. Examines the ecology, evolution, and diversity of life. Topics to be covered include population ecology, population genetics, evolution, phylogeny and classification, and a survey of the Animal Kingdom—including trends in animal evolution.
BIO-203L Ecology, Evolution & Diversity Laboratory1 credit
Corequisites: BIO-203
This is the laboratory course for BIO-203. Includes discussion, field study, and laboratory experience
